Originally Posted By: cmatera I have both. For the $$ the Alpha Dog cannot be beat. Recently, it was available for $149.00! Easy to read color remote, sounds in categories, a built in sound, loud (with good batteries, like ALL e-callers). The Fusion has the excellent to see TX-1000 remote, and lot more features (some of which you may not need or ever use, but you can "grow" into it). It is also almost four times the price, so it not really a fair comparison. For the $$, the Alpha Dog cannot be beat. If $$ is not an issue and you want all the latest features to fool around with or may like to use in the future, get the Fusion. I also got the SP-55 speaker to go with it. Either way, you can't go wrong.
